[devel] libextractor-0.5.18a-alt1 -- libtool?

Alexey Tourbin =?iso-8859-1?q?at_=CE=C1_altlinux=2Eru?=
Пн Янв 21 21:59:01 MSK 2008


>  libextractor-0.5.18a-alt1	Provides	libextractor.so.1
> +libextractor-0.5.18a-alt1	Requires	/usr/lib/libextractor/libextractor_exiv2.so.0.0.0
>  libextractor-0.5.18a-alt1	Requires	libc.so.6(GLIBC_2.0)

Выяснилось одно отстойное обстоятельство.

Либтул теперь стал как-то по-другому линковать некоторые библиотеки
и/или плагины.  То что раньше было *.so файлом теперь стало симлинком
на *.so.0.0.0.

Вот разница в логах сборки пакета libextractor
old-logs/i586/2007/1118/success/libextractor-0.5.18a-alt1 success/libextractor-0.5.18a-alt1

 warning: Installed (but unpackaged) file(s) found:
+    /usr/lib/libextractor/libextractor_exiv2.so.0
+    /usr/lib/libextractor/libextractor_exiv2.so.0.0.0
     /usr/lib/pkgconfig/libextractor.pc
     /usr/share/info/extractor.info.bz2
 Wrote: /usr/src/RPM/RPMS/i586/libextractor-0.5.18a-alt1.i586.rpm
...

Вот разница между самими пакетами.
Пакет что лежит в сизифе:

$ less libextractor-0.5.18a-alt1.i586.rpm |grep libextractor_exiv2
-rw-r--r--    1 root    root           522092 Oct 11 20:45 /usr/lib/libextractor/libextractor_exiv2.so
$

Пакет после тестовой пересборки:
$ less libextractor-0.5.18a-alt1.x86_64.rpm |grep libextractor_exiv2
lrwxrwxrwx    1 root    root               27 Jan 21 21:56 /usr/lib64/libextractor/libextractor_exiv2.so -> libextractor_exiv2.so.0.0.0
$

Может кто-нибудь поможет нам разобраться, в чём там дело,
и в каких ещё пакетах это дело всплывает?
----------- следующая часть -----------
Было удалено вложение не в текстовом формате...
Имя     : =?iso-8859-1?q?=CF=D4=D3=D5=D4=D3=D4=D7=D5=C5=D4?=
Тип     : application/pgp-signature
Размер  : 197 байтов
Описание: =?iso-8859-1?q?=CF=D4=D3=D5=D4=D3=D4=D7=D5=C5=D4?=
Url     : <http://lists.altlinux.org/pipermail/devel/attachments/20080121/57be200e/attachment-0002.bin>


Подробная информация о списке рассылки Devel